Cargando…

FedMSA: A Model Selection and Adaptation System for Federated Learning

Federated Learning (FL) enables multiple clients to train a shared model collaboratively without sharing any personal data. However, selecting a model and adapting it quickly to meet user expectations in a large-scale FL application with heterogeneous devices is challenging. In this paper, we propos...

Descripción completa

Detalles Bibliográficos
Autores principales: Sun, Rui, Li, Yinhao, Shah, Tejal, Sham, Ringo W. H., Szydlo, Tomasz, Qian, Bin, Thakker, Dhaval, Ranjan, Rajiv
Formato: Online Artículo Texto
Lenguaje:English
Publicado: MDPI 2022
Materias:
Acceso en línea:https://www.ncbi.nlm.nih.gov/pmc/articles/PMC9571508/
https://www.ncbi.nlm.nih.gov/pubmed/36236343
http://dx.doi.org/10.3390/s22197244
Descripción
Sumario:Federated Learning (FL) enables multiple clients to train a shared model collaboratively without sharing any personal data. However, selecting a model and adapting it quickly to meet user expectations in a large-scale FL application with heterogeneous devices is challenging. In this paper, we propose a model selection and adaptation system for Federated Learning (FedMSA), which includes a hardware-aware model selection algorithm that trades-off model training efficiency and model performance base on FL developers’ expectation. Meanwhile, considering the expected model should be achieved by dynamic model adaptation, FedMSA supports full automation in building and deployment of the FL task to different hardware at scale. Experiments on benchmark and real-world datasets demonstrate the effectiveness of the model selection algorithm of FedMSA in real devices (e.g., Raspberry Pi and Jetson nano).